当前位置:首页 > 系统教程 > 正文

Ubuntu22.04部署CosyVoice全攻略(从零开始搭建AI语音合成系统)

Ubuntu22.04部署CosyVoice全攻略(从零开始搭建AI语音合成系统)

本教程将详细指导您在Ubuntu22.04系统上部署CosyVoice,这是一个强大的AI语音合成工具。无论您是小白还是经验丰富的开发者,都能跟随步骤轻松完成。我们将覆盖从环境准备到运行测试的全过程,确保您能快速上手CosyVoice,享受语音合成技术带来的便利。

Ubuntu22.04部署CosyVoice全攻略(从零开始搭建AI语音合成系统) Ubuntu22.04  CosyVoice 语音合成 AI部署 第1张

准备工作

在开始部署CosyVoice之前,请确保您的系统是Ubuntu22.04。这是最新的LTS版本,提供了稳定的基础支持。同时,检查网络连接,以便下载必要的依赖包。我们将使用命令行操作,所以请打开终端。关键词如Ubuntu22.04CosyVoice是本教程的核心,您将在整个过程中频繁接触它们。

步骤一:安装系统依赖

首先,更新系统包列表并安装基础工具。在终端中运行以下命令:

sudo apt updatesudo apt upgrade -ysudo apt install -y python3 python3-pip git curl

这些命令将确保您的Ubuntu22.04系统处于最新状态,并安装Python3和Git,这是运行CosyVoice所必需的。AI部署通常需要这些基础组件,请耐心等待安装完成。

步骤二:克隆CosyVoice仓库

接下来,从GitHub获取CosyVoice的源代码。使用git克隆仓库:

git clone https://github.com/cosyvoice/cosyvoice.gitcd cosyvoice

这将在当前目录创建cosyvoice文件夹。CosyVoice是一个开源的语音合成项目,支持多种语言和声音模型。进入目录后,我们将配置环境。

步骤三:配置Python环境

建议使用虚拟环境来隔离依赖。运行以下命令:

python3 -m venv venvsource venv/bin/activatepip install -r requirements.txt

这将创建一个名为venv的虚拟环境并激活它,然后安装CosyVoice所需的所有Python包。语音合成技术依赖于深度学习库,如TensorFlow或PyTorch,这些通常包含在requirements.txt中。

步骤四:运行和测试CosyVoice

完成安装后,您可以启动CosyVoice进行测试。根据项目文档,运行示例命令:

python3 demo.py --text "欢迎使用CosyVoice语音合成系统"

如果一切顺利,您将听到生成的语音输出。这标志着AI部署成功。您可以在Ubuntu22.04上探索更多功能,如自定义声音模型或批量处理。

总结

通过本教程,您已经学会了在Ubuntu22.04上部署CosyVoice的全过程。从安装依赖到运行测试,每个步骤都旨在简化操作。关键词如语音合成AI部署是未来技术趋势,掌握它们将助您在AI领域更进一步。如有问题,请参考CosyVoice官方文档或社区支持。